Snippet
Twenty agonists and nine antagonists were evaluated for their ability to compete for [3H]-8- hydroxy-2-(di-n-propylamino) tetralin ([3H]-8-OH-DPAT) binding to the cloned human serotonin-1A (ch-5-HT1A) receptor expressed in Chinese hamster ovary cells and for their …
